SBS Group Named to Accounting Today's Top VAR 100 List

SBS Group is recognized as one of Accounting Today Magazine's VAR 100 for the seventh consecutive year.

2010-08-27
WOODBRIDGE, NJ, August 27, 2010 (Press-News.org) SBS Group is recognized as one of Accounting Today Magazine's VAR 100 for the seventh consecutive year. With offices in New Jersey, New York, Philadelphia, Boston and New Orleans, SBS Group provides mid-market accounting & technology solutions to companies along the East & Gulf Coasts. SBS Group, ranked #34, is one of a handful of companies to achieve this honor for the past six years. The VAR 100 companies are selected based upon their 2009 revenue. More than one thousand companies are considered for inclusion in the annual listing and the top 100 are then selected for publication.

"Our continual recognition as one of the Top 100 VARs attests to the value we deliver our clients. SBS is proud to consistently provide excellent customer service in the areas of business process assessment, consulting, implementation, training and support for business management solutions including Microsoft Dynamics," states James R. Bowman, Jr., President of SBS Group.

"We pride ourselves for working with, not just for our clients and helping them turn business challenges into technology solutions," states Mr. Bowman.

About SBS Group
SBS Group provides business management solutions to mid-size companies across the country. SBS delivers its solutions and services with the industry's top technology partners including Microsoft, Sage Software, Deltek, IBM, Hewlett Packard, Citrix, Cognos and others. Focused on distribution, manufacturing, supply chain management, customer relationship management, financial management, project management, service management and accounting solutions, SBS Group has over 24 years of working with clients, not just for them. The SBS team has earned an award-winning reputation, having been recognized as a Microsoft Gold Partner, Microsoft Partner of the Year (Dynamics SL), New Jersey Best Places to Work Winner, NJBIZ Business of the Year Finalist, IBM Beacon Award recipient and Sage Software Leadership Academy member. The company is headquartered in Woodbridge, New Jersey and operates other offices in New York, Philadelphia, Boston, Washington, DC, New Orleans, Houston, Oklahoma City, Baton Rouge and Toledo. More information about SBS Group can be found at http://www.sbsgroupusa.com.

Screen printing for the personalisation of clothing has been around for many hundreds of years. The basic principle has not changed apart for the automation and modern electronic controls. A silk screen is produced and a template that covers the screen allows ink to be pushed through the screen depositing the ink on the garment. In its basic form only spot colours can be printed and a screen has to be prepared for each colour printed.
